Love Revolution by Baby J (Jenny Carrington) Makes Its Live Debut at EarthVibes Festival in Furtherance of Global Unity

A new generation of Earth TUNES aims to bring unity, optimism, and conscious dance-pop to mainstream audiences

NEW YORK, NY, UNITED STATES, June 23, 2026 /EINPresswire.com/ — Conscious-pop artist Baby J (Jenny Carrington) gave the first public performance of her upcoming single, “Love Revolution,” at the 2026 EarthVibes Music & Wellness Festival, offering audiences a preview of the song ahead of the release of her forthcoming album, Cosmosis.

Held in Farmingdale, New Jersey, EarthVibes welcomed approximately 700 ticket holders, with an estimated 400–500 attendees participating throughout the weekend despite an extreme regional heat wave. Produced by Touch Mother Earth led by long-time drummers and community-leaders Cheryl Miller Glover and Dave Miller, the festival brought together musicians, wellness practitioners, artists, and community leaders for a celebration of music, healing, sustainability, and connection.

Carrington serves on the Board of Directors of Touch Mother Earth Non-Profit while also representing Mother Earth International, supporting organizational oversight, partnership development, and fundraising initiatives. She described the festival as the ideal environment to introduce a song centered on unity, presence, and collective wellbeing.

“Love Revolution is rooted in a simple idea: love is not just an emotion, it’s a force for transformation,” said Carrington. “The song invites people to experience connection through breath, movement, and shared humanity. EarthVibes felt like the perfect place to begin that journey.”

More than a music festival, EarthVibes represents a living example of the values at the heart of Love Revolution—community, healing, sustainability, and human connection, making it the perfect place to launch a Love Revolution.

The performance was made possible through the generosity of festival headliner Tabitha Booth & Friends, who invited Carrington to debut Love Revolution during the closing set. In addition to premiering the song, Carrington was also invited to perform alongside Booth and her band throughout the final act—an opportunity she described as a meaningful honor and one of the highlights of the festival.

“Sharing the stage with Tabitha Booth, who is my dear friend and a wildly talented artist, was incredibly special,” said Carrington. “Tabitha created space for this song, and the deeper messages behind our shares improvised melodies to be heard in exactly the kind of community it was written for—one rooted in connection, healing, music, and joy.”
